Nine newly elected UP Council members take oath

Nine of the 13 newly elected members of Uttar Pradesh Legislative Council were today administrated the oath of House.

Chairman of the Legislative Council, Ganesh Shanker Pandey administered oath to the newly elected members in the presence of Chief Minister Akhilesh Yadav, who is also a member of the Upper House of the state legislature.

Except for the three Bahujan Samaj Party (BSP) members and Ramesh Yadav of SP, all the newly elected members of the Uttar Pradesh Legislative Council took the oath.

Recently, 12 members, namely Ahmad Hasan, Ramesh Yadav, Ramjatan Rajbhar, Sahab Singh Saini, Ashok Bajpai, Virendra Singh Gurjar, Sarojini Agarwal and Ashu Malik (SP), Naseemuddin Siddiqui, Dharmveer Ashok and Pradeep (BSP) and Lakshman Acharya (BJP) got elected from the Assembly constituency, while one Arun Pathak was elected from Kanpur-Unnao Teachers' constituency.
